Cannabis legalization has concerned many businesses as the thought of a new industry cutting into their profits becomes a valid possibility. Alcohol companies in particular were worried that the debut of legal retail cannabis in Colorado and Washington would result in a sales dip. But has it?
Quite the contrary, actually. Since Colorado legalized recreational cannabis 18 months ago, alcohol sales have “seen phenomenal growth,” according to Justin Martz, the owner of a wine and spirits store in Denver:
“…it’s really turned out to be a non-issue … if anything else it’s kind of helped us. A high tide lifts all boats.”
